I have WiFi problem... My DX200 can't see 5GHz network. Only 2.4GHz is visible. And in DX200 WiFi advanced config menu  there is no option to switch between 2.4 or 5GHz...
 
How to connect to 5GHz? In my place is about 15 2.4GHz networks and I prefer 5GHz - it's more stable and faster. And DX200 has no hiss with 5GHz net.
 
Mar 18, 2017 at 5:33 AM Post #5,306 of 22,021
I have WiFi problem... My DX200 can't see 5GHz network. Only 2.4GHz is visible. And in DX200 WiFi advanced config menu  there is no option to switch between 2.4 or 5GHz...

How to connect to 5GHz? In my place is about 15 2.4GHz networks and I prefer 5GHz - it's more stable and faster. And DX200 has no hiss with 5GHz net.


If You have an access to router's settings, try to change 5GHz network's channel. Also had this problem, my unit works with channel 36, but I didn't get to know any pattern for it. Just try to change your channel and turn off and on WiFi in your DAP.
 
Mar 18, 2017 at 6:49 AM Post #5,307 of 22,021
If You have an access to router's settings, try to change 5GHz network's channel. Also had this problem, my unit works with channel 36, but I didn't get to know any pattern for it. Just try to change your channel and turn off and on WiFi in your DAP.

 




thx!

channel 36 is working, channel 108 is invisible
